First to hatch on day 16. Set 48 Texas A&M that we're shipped. So far 6 have hatched! This is more exciting than Christmas morning! This was a dry incubation I started at 100.5 degrees and about 30% RH. At lock down dropped temp to 98.5-99.0 and set humidity at 70%. Well as thing have progressed we have 23 hatched and kicking, and 1 that just seemed to give up in the shell as it had PIP'd and then did move after that for some time. It seemed to be still attached to the eggs membrane or Hadn't taken the yolk all in at any rate it looked shrink wrapped on top but the bottom was still moist upon inspection. I did help one out of the shell that had Piped a rather large hole and was like that for about 13hrs. I just zipped the shell for it and it pushed itself out it was very small and had curled feet. I am gonna leave it for a day or so to see if it corrects itself. Crazy how addicting this is!
I must say these eggs were purchased on EBAY and shipped. I think they are doing well for shipped eggs. I let them sit for 24 hrs then set them. I hope more hatch but if they don't I will be very pleased either way! Happy hatching everyone!
